#d49adc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d49adc is composed of 83.1% red, 60.4%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.6% cyan, 30%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 292.7 degrees, a saturation of 48.5% and a lightness of 73.3%. #d49adc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a935b9.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#d49adc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d49adc has RGB values of R:212, G:154,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.3,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 13933276.

Hex triplet d49adc #d49adc
RGB Decimal 212, 154, 220 rgb(212,154,220)
RGB Percent 83.1, 60.4, 86.3 rgb(83.1%,60.4%,86.3%)
CMYK 4, 30, 0, 14
HSL 292.7°, 48.5, 73.3 hsl(292.7,48.5%,73.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 292.7°, 30, 86.3
Web Safe cc99cc #cc99cc
CIE-LAB 71.061, 32.685, -25.057
XYZ 51.624, 42.277, 73.147
xyY 0.309, 0.253, 42.277
CIE-LCH 71.061, 41.185, 322.525
CIE-LUV 71.061, 27.969, -44.347
Hunter-Lab 65.021, 27.935, -21.186
Binary 11010100, 10011010, 11011100

Shades and Tints of #d49adc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f9f1f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#d49adc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bcb9bd is the less saturated color, while #ec7bfb is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#d49adc is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#b3b3b3 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#baaebb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#a1b0e8 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#adaed8 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#cfa7b3 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#b3a8e4 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#bba7da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#d1a2c2 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
